Love Patchwork & Quilting - Issue 67

Issue 67 of Love Patchwork & Quilting has arrived with the winter breeze, filled with a cool and crisp array of projects!

Sew Shannon Fraser’s striking cover quilt with bold lines and clashing colors, or opt for something a little more frosty… From Michelle Wilkie’s soothing snowdrift quilt to Anna Marie Galvin’s present-packed throw, Moira de Carvalho’s meditative curves to Louisa Goult’s smattering of EPP stars, you’ll find something seasonal to make on every page. Plus! Top up your block repertoire with our twenty modern block reference cards.

  • Create a quilt with waves of movement and unity using twisting and turning HST units and clever color placement
  • Combine sharp diamonds, contemporary curves and EPP to create this modern star design stitched up in cool Christmas hues
  • Earthy tones, subtle prints and negative space unite to form a crush-worthy quilt that is as much at home on a wall as a sofa!
  • Dig out your cutest winter prints to sew a patchwork quilt for a snoozy Foundation Paper Pieced penguin and his fishy friend
  • Combine cool coastal curves with seaside stripes and True Blue prints for a fresh quilt with a nautical twist
  • As a quilter, it never hurts to have a few tricks up your sleeve and with this month’s gift – a set of 20 modern quilt blocks by Lynne Goldsworthy – you’ll always have plenty of inspiration to hand!
